| Dates | Characters | Theories and discoveries |
| 1961 | Sheldon Glashow | Introduces neutral intermediate boson of electro-weak interactions |
| 1961 | Jeoffrey Goldstone | Theory of massless particles in spontaneous symmetry breaking (Goldstone boson) |
| 1961 | Gell-Mann and Ne’eman | The eightfold way, SU(3) octet symmetry of hadrons |
| 1961 | Robert Dicke | Weak anthropic principle |
| 1961 | Robert Hofstadter | Nucleons have an internal structure |
| 1961 | Ghiorso, Sikkeland, Larsh, Latimer | Element 103, lawrencium |
| 1961 | Edward Ohm | Prior detection of CMBR, but not identified |
| 1961 | Edward Lorenz | Chaos theory |
| 1961 | Yuri Gagarin | First man in space |
| 1961 | Geoffrey Chew | Nuclear democracy and the bootstrap model |
| 1961 | Tulio Regge | Simplicial lattice general relativity |
| 1962 | Gell-Mann and Ne’eman | Prediction of Omega minus particle |
| 1962 | Leith and Upatnieks | First hologram |
| 1962 | Giacconi, Gursky, Paolini, Rossi | Detection of cosmic X-rays |
| 1962 | Brian Josephson | Theory of Jesephson effect |
| 1962 | Lederman, Steinberger, Schwartz | Evidence for more than one type of neutrino |
| 1962 | Hogarth | Proposes relation between cosmological and thermodynamic arrows of time |
| 1962 | Thomas Gold | Time-symmetric universe |
| 1962 | Benoit Mandelbrot | Fractal images |
| 1963 | Samios et al | Baryon Omega minus found |
| 1963 | Philip Anderson | Gauge theories can evade Goldstone theorem |
| 1963 | Roy Kerr | Solution for a rotating black hole |
| 1963 | Schmidt, Greensite, Sandage | Quasars are distant |
| 1963 | Nicola Cabibbo | Weak mixing angle |
| 1964 | Brout, Englert, Higgs | Higgs mechanism of symmetry breaking |
| 1964 | Hoyle, Taylor, Zeldovich | Big bang nucleosynthesis of helium |
| 1964 | Steven Weinberg | Baryon number is probably not conserved |
| 1964 | Christenson, Cronin, Fitch, Turlay | CP violation in weak interactions |
| 1964 | Gell-Mann, Zweig | Quark theory of hadrons |
| 1964 | Murray Gell-Mann | Current algebra |
| 1964 | Bjorken and Glashow | Prediciton of SU(4) flavour symmetry and charm |
| 1964 | Roger Penrose | Black holes must contain singularities |
| 1964 | Ginzburg, Doroshkevich, Novikov, Zel’dovich | Black holes have no hair |
| 1964 | Salpeter and Zel’dovich | Black holes power quasars and radio galaxies |
| 1964 | John Bell | A quantum inequality which limits the possibilities for local hidden variable theories |
| 1964 | John Wheeler | Foundations of canonical formulism for gravity |
| 1964 | soviets | Element 104, rutherfordium |
| 1964 | Salam, Ward | SU(2)xU(1) model of electro-weak unification |
| 1964 | X-ray source Cygnus X-1 discovered | |
| 1964 | Thomas Kibble | Higgs mechanism for Yang-Mills theory |
| 1965 | Greenberg, Han, Nambu | SU(3) colour symmetry to explain statistics of quark model |
| 1965 | Zabusky and Kruskal | Numerical studies of solitons |
| 1965 | Penzias and Wilson | Detection of the cosmic background radiation |
| 1965 | Dicke, Peebles, Roll, Wilkinson | Indentification of cosmic background radiation |
| 1965 | Rees and Sciama | Quasars were more numerable in the past |
| 1967 | Steven Weinberg | Electro-weak unification |
| 1967 | Bell and Hewish | Pulsars |
| 1967 | Irwin Shapiro | Radar measurment of relativistic time delays to Mercury |
| 1967 | John Wheeler | Introduced the term “black hole” |
| 1967 | Andrei Sakharov | Three criteria for cosmological abundance of matter over anti-matter |
| 1967 | soviets | Element 105, dubnium |
| 1968 | Joseph Weber | First attempt at a gravitational wave detector |
| 1968 | Brandon Carter | Strong anthropic principle |
| 1968 | Gabriele Veneziano | Dual resonance model for strong interaction, beginning of string theory |
| 1968 | James Bjorken | Theory of scaling behavior in deep inelastic scattering |
| 1968 | Richard Feynman | Scaling and parton model of nucleons |
| 1969 | Kendall, Friedman | Taylor Deep inelastic scattering experiments find structure inside protons |
| 1969 | Ellis, Hawking & Penrose | Singularity theorems for the big bang |
| 1969 | Roger Penrose | Conjectures that singularities are hidden by cosmic censorship |
| 1969 | Donald Lynden-Bell | Black hole at the centre of galactic nuclei |
| 1969 | Raymond Davis | Solar neutrino detector |
| 1969 | Charles Misner | Cosmological horizon problem revisited |
| 1969 | Robert Dicke | Cosmological flatness problem |
| 1969 | Neil Armstrong | First man on the moon |
| 1969 | First attempts to verify solar deflection of radio waves from quasars | |
| 1969 | David Finkelstein | Space-time code |
| 1970 | Claude Lovelace, Veneziano | Amplitude has special properties in 26 dimensions |
| 1970 | Nambu, Nielsen, Susskind | Realisation that the dual resonance model is string theory |
| 1970 | Goto, Hara, Nambu | Action for bosonic string as area of world sheet |
| 1970 | Simon Van der Meer | Stochastic cooling for particle beams |
| 1970 | Glashow, Iliopoulos, Maiani | GIM mechanism and prediction of charm quark |
| 1970 | Stephen Hawking | The surface area of a black holes event horizon always increases |
| 1971 | Kenneth Wilson | The operator product expansion and the renormalisation group for the strong force |
| 1971 | Dimopolous, Fayet, Gol’fand, Lichtman | Supersymmetry |
| 1971 | Ramond, Neveu, Schwarz | String theory of bosons and fermions with critical dimension 10 |
| 1971 | ‘t Hooft, Veltman, Lee | Renormalisation of elctro-weak model |
| 1971 | Roger Penrose | Spin networks |
| 1971 | Bolton, Murdin | Webster Cygnus X-1 identified as black hole candidate |
| 1972 | Jacob Bekenstein | Black hole entropy |
| 1972 | Fritsch, Gell-Mann, Bardeen | Quantum Chromodynamics |
| 1972 | Kirzhnits, Linde | Electro-Weak phase transition |
| 1972 | Roger Penrose | Twistors |
| 1972 | Salam, Pati | SU(4)xSU(4) unification and proton decay |
| 1972 | Tom Bolton | Cygnus X-1 identified as black hole |
| 1973 | Wess and Zumino | Space-time supersymmetry |
| 1973 | Ostriker and Peebles | Dark matter in galaxies |
| 1973 | CERN | Evidence of weak neutral currents |
| 1973 | ‘t Hooft, Gross, Politzer, Wilczek, Coleman | T of asymptotic freedom in non-abelian gauge theories |
| 1973 | Klebesadel, Strong, Olson | Gamma Ray Bursts are cosmic |
| 1973 | Edward Tyron | The universe as a quantum fluctuation |
| 1974 | Yoneya, Scherk, Schwarz | Interpretation of string theory as a theory of gravity |
| 1974 | Ting and Richter | Found J/psi, charmed quark |
| 1974 | Kenneth Wilson | Lattice gauge theory |
| 1974 | Taylor and Hulse | Binary pulsar and relativistic effects |
| 1974 | Kobayashi and Maskawa | CKM mixing matrix; CP violation in weak interaction requires three generations |
| 1974 | Georgi and Glashow | SU(5) as Grand Unified Theory and prediction of proton decay |
| 1974 | Georgi, Weinberg, Quinn | Convergence of coupling constants at GUT scale |
| 1974 | ‘t Hooft, Okun, Polyakov | Heavy magnetic monopoles exist in GUTs. |
| 1974 | Stephen Hawking | Black hole radiation and thermodynamics |
| 1974 | soviets and americans | Element 106, seaborgium |
| 1975 | Martin Perl | Tau lepton |
| 1975 | Gail Hanson | Quark jets |
| 1975 | Chincarini and Rood | Lumpiness in galaxy distributions |
| 1975 | Unruh and Davies | Acceleration radiation effect |
| 1975 | Mitchell Feigenbaum | Universality in chaotic non-linear systems |
| 1975 | Belavin, Polyakov, Schwartz | Tyupkin instantons in Yang-Mills theory |
| 1976 | Scherk, Gliozzi, Olive | Supersymmetric string theory |
| 1976 | Deser, Freedman, Van Nieuwenhuizen, Ferrara, Zumino | Supergravity |
| 1976 | Levine and Vessot | Precision test of gravitational time dilation on rocket |
| 1976 | Gerard ‘t Hooft | The instantons solution of the U(1) anomaly |
| 1976 | soviets | Element 107, bohrium |
| 1977 | James Elliot | Rings of Uranus |
| 1977 | Olive and Montenen | Conjecture of elecro-magnetic duality |
| 1977 | Fermilab | Bottom quark |
| 1977 | Klaus von Klitzing | Quantum Hall effect |
| 1977 | Tifft, Gregory, Joeveer, Einasto, Thompson | Clusters chains and voids in galaxy dustributions |
| 1977 | Berkley | Dipole anisotropy on cosmic background radiation |
| 1977 | Leon Lederman | Upsilon, bottom quark |
| 1977 | Gunn, Schramm, Steigman | Cosmological constraints imply that there are only three light neutrinos |
| 1978 | James Christy | Charon moon of Pluto |
| 1978 | Taylor and Hulse | Evidence for gravitational radiation of binary pulsar |
| 1978 | Cremmer, Julia, Nahm, Scherk | 11-dimensional supergravity |
| 1978 | Prescott, Taylor | Elctro-weak effect on electron polarisation |
| 1979 | Voyager | Rings of Jupiter |
| 1979 | John Preskill | Cosmological monopole problem |
| 1979 | Walsh, Carswell, Weymann | Quasar doubled by gravitational lensing |
| 1979 | DESY | Evidence for gluons in hadron Jets |
| 1979 | Alexei Starobinsky | Inflationary universe |
| 1980 | Frederick Reines | Evidence of Neutrino oscillations |
| 1980 | DESY | Measurement of gluon spin |
| 1980 | Alan Guth | Inflationary early universe |
